UFO报错"默认帐套不存在"
- 浏览:1264 - 发布时间:2008-01-08 00:00:00.0
问题版本: |
802-U8.51A |
问题模块: |
2-UFO报表 |
所属行业: |
0-通用 |
问题状态: |
2-UU通注册用户 |
关 键 字: |
默认帐套不存在 |
适用产品: |
U85X--财务会计--UFO报表 |
补 丁 号: |
|
开放状态: |
0-UU通注册用户 |
原问题号: |
|
提交时间: |
2008-1-8 |
问题名称: |
UFO报错"默认帐套不存在" |
问题现象: |
UFO报错"默认帐套不存在':在UFO取数时报函数输入错误,重新设置公式时,在点击参照时报错"默认帐套不存在"。 |
原因分析: |
出现该问题的原因是由于开发通过补丁对U8中的操作员密码加密算法做过修改,而UFO中在参照公式时,系统会调用UFSYSTEM系统数据库UA_USER表中系统内置操作员“asuser”,然后通过asuser操作员实现后台资源的访问、调用。由于asuser用户的口令是系统预制的也是:asuser(切记不要随意修改),UFO程序通过asuser用户对后台资源的访问、调用时,程序代码中对于asuser用户赋予的口令是一常量“asuser”。这样一来新的加密算法改变后,“asuser”字符串(指程序代码中对于asus |
解决方案: |
1、在系统管理中修改某用户(如AAA)的口令为asusr,可得到新加密算法生成的UA_USER表中CPASSWORD字段值。 2、在UA_USER表中用AAA用户记录的cpassword字段值替换asuser用户记录cpassword的字段值即可. | |